review the paragraph about the popularity of the ford model t car. in the early 1900s, engineer henry ford set out to build a car that was cost - effective, easy to operate, and durable. the result was the ford model t. by using one of the first production assembly lines to manufacture his new automobile, ford was able to create well - built cars more quickly and more affordably than his competitors. many people from my hometown worked on the model t assembly line. customers flocked to buy fords vehicles due to their price and reliability. the first model t was sold in 1908, and by the early 1920s, more than half of the automobiles on the worlds roads were fords. the model t was finally retired from production in 1927, but not before over fifteen million vehicles had been sold. why should the bolded sentence be removed? it provides information that is off topic. it provides information that is redundant. it provides unnecessary personal information.
Answer
Brief Explanations:
The paragraph is about the Ford Model T's popularity and production - related facts. The bolded sentence about people from the writer's hometown is personal information not relevant to the main topic.
Answer:
It provides unnecessary personal information.
